Telenet Japan (Japanese: 日本テレネット, Nihon/Hippon Terenetto) is a Japanese video game and software developer founded in October 1983 by Kazuyuki Fukushima. The company is also known as Nippon Telenet (or Nihon Telenet). The company is best known for the Valis series as well as its Wolfteam & RiOT divisions ( the former of which created Tales of Phantasia, the first game in the Tales series). The company's North American subsidiary, Renovation Products was eventually acquired by Sega. The company closed its doors on October 25th, 2007.[1]
